April 18, 2016
Little, Brown & Company
Market Place Center
3 Center Plaza
Boston, MA 02108
ATTENTION: LEGAL COUNSEL
RE: Proposed nook by James Patterson regarding
Jeffrey Epstein
Dear Sir or Madam:
Steptoe
$TEPTOE I JOHNSON Ur
On December 3, 2015 Martin G Weinberg authored a letter that was
hand-delivered to Little, Brown & Co addressing concerns regarding a
proposed book about Jeffrey Epstein, see attached letter. At the time Mr.
Weinberg understood that the author was John Connolly. No response to
that letter has been received. Mr. Weinberg received both by email and
fedex a letter dated April 14, 2016, addressed to Mr. Epstein, and authored
by James Patterson representing that a book about Mr. Epstein titled "Filthy
Rich" was intended for publication this August. Again, both Mr. Weinberg
and I want to provide you with clear notice that Mr. Epstein has been the
past subject of repeated and widespread untruthful, inaccurate, and
defamatory media coverage. It would be in reckless disregard for the truth if
a book relying in whole or in part on such media coverage were published or
if a book relying on biased and provably untruthful or unreliable sources of
information became the basis for further prejudicial publicity about Mr.
Epstein. Given that James Patterson is being named as author (or co-
author), the proposed book is likely to generate an even wider audience
although large portions of the book may be predicated on Mr. Connolly's
investigation and writing. Accordingly, we reserve any and all legal rights

to contest the basis for any inaccurate or untruthful information contained in
any future publication.
In order to diminish the likelihood of the book containing defamatory
falsehoods that could, if known in advance, be identified and redacted, and
to begin a communication that I hope would result in a more accurate book
if and when it is released, Mr. Weinberg and I would request a meeting with
you at which we could address the concerns raised above.
Very truly yours,
Reid H. Weingarten
